I've not heard that one before, but lift the bonnet and check the left hand side at the back in front of the steering wheel. There is a bare area there that collects water from the sunroof drain and channels it down to the front wheel arch. If that area is full of leaves you will have a big puddle that 'could' be finding its way to your ankles

I had a leak behind the dash after having a new screen fitted. There is a cable grommet behind the heater inlet which had been moved and just needed reseating.
